As such, today we present an abstract showcase of the Fall Winter 2009 collections from TheCorner.com by acclaimed British fashion photographer and filmmaker Nick Knight and ShowStudio. Entitled ‘Portent’, the film is a series of short sequences shown in ornate baroque frames, as a dreamy heroine’s wardrobe shifts from designer to designer, beginning with a look from Kris Van Assche.
Through the piece – as she reclines on a plush chaise, plucks sad petals from a flower or poses delicately by candlelight – the model wears outfits from A#1′s Maison Martin Margiela, A#2′s Haider Ackermann and past contributors Rick Owens, Raf Simons and Ann Demeulemeester. With a glimpse from the early days of the ‘A’ story, Hussein Chalayan (from NºC) and Viktor & Rolf (NºE) are also featured. Each designer provides a dramatic and sensual silhouette – with Knight’s soft and shadowy atmosphere emphasizing the texture and sheen of TheCorner.com’s handpicked selection.
